Read for yourself here, a report written by Founder and Editor of the Impartial Independant website MARTIN LEWIS: moneysavingexpert/family/grant-grabbing Grants and schemes to help you save money on energy bills You may be able to get help with the cost of insulating your home or making it more energy-efficient through various grants and schemes. This can help you reduce your gas and electricity bills. This NEXT SECTION explains two of the main schemes, the Energy Companies Obligation (ECO) a UK scheme. (if you are eligible, you can get these measures from an energy supplier, whether or not they actually supply energy to you) and the Nest Programme which operates only in Wales. It also explains how you can find out whether you’re eligible. Top tips Making your home more energy-efficient won’t just reduce your bills. It will also lower your carbon emissions. How the Energy Company Obligation scheme can help Under the Carbon Saving Communities Obligation (CSCO) - it provides help with insulation and glazing if you: live in a specified postcode area or live in a low-income household in a rural area. This means you live in private or social housing, in a population of under 10,000 homes and get, or someone who lives with you gets, the same benefits as you need for the Affordable Warmth Scheme. The Carbon Emissions Reduction Obligation (CERO) - it provides help with solid wall and cavity wall insulation for households in hard to treat homes. Under the Home Heating Cost Reduction Obligation (HHCRO) – the Affordable Warmth Scheme - it provides help with all or part of the cost of loft or cavity wall insulation or boiler repairs or replacements if you:own your home outright, or have a mortgage, or are a tenant, and get, or someone who lives with you gets certain benefits under the Affordable Warmth Scheme.If you are a social housing tenant you may not get this help but you may be able to get help under CSCO. Benefits you must get to be eligible for help under the Affordable Warmth Scheme Youre eligible for the Affordable Warmth Scheme if you or someone who lives with you gets the following benefits: State Pension Credit or Child Tax Credit (with your relevant income below £15,860) OR, a combination of these benefits: One of these: Income based Job Seeker’s Allowance Income related Employment and Support Allowance Income Support. Plus at least one from this list must apply: Disabled Child Premium parental responsibility for a child under 16 years of age, who lives at the property parental responsibility for a child aged 16 or over but under 20, who lives at the property and is in full-time education (not in higher education, such as at a university) Pensioner Premium, higher pensioner premium or enhanced pensioner premium Child Tax Credit which includes a disability or severe disability element Disability Premium, enhanced disability premium, or severe disability premium Work related activity or support component (with Income related Employment & Support Allowance only) OR, a combination of: Working Tax Credit (with your relevant income below £15,860) Plus at least one from this list must apply: parental responsibility for a child under 16 who lives at the property parental responsibility for a child aged 16 or over but under 20, who lives at the property and is in full-time education (not in higher education, such as at a university) Disabled Worker Element or Severe Disability Element aged 60 or over. Who needs to agree before the work can be done If you are a tenant or a leaseholder, you will usually need the agreement of the landlord before you can have any work done. Landlords can also apply under the scheme. If you are a landlord, you will usually need the agreement of the tenant or leaseholder before you can have any work done. If you live in the property and own the freehold, you will not need anyone elses agreement before you can have any work done.
